I'm back from the amazingness of Thailand. The crazy heat/humidity combo nearly killed me, but I still can't wait to go back. Learned how to make Thai food, did some typical jungling activities (rafting, vip cording and the like), and went to an elephant sactuary that was an incredible experience. And got eaten alive by mosquitoes! Great fun, great fun.

And, just like I predicted, we didn't end up getting the tattoos. My mom thought that it would be a nice bounding experience to get cute little matching tattoos... so when I researched them and told her that it wasn't just some cute tattoo, but that they were considered sacred and that you couldn't get just anything, she decided she didn't want to do it after all. It's gotten me very interested in them though, so I'm going to do a lot more research this summer and think about getting one when I go back. Right now I'm thinking about getting a sacred Na instead of a Sak Yant, because generally they're simpler, and this particular one is about kindness and compassion. But I also really like the Yant Bua Gaew, though I can't find as much information about it.

Thai Buddhism was really interesting and something I need to research more. It was completely different than the Seon Buddhism that I study in Korea, which I was expecting, but I didn't realize how different it would be. It seems like a lot of Hindu deities are still very important to the religion, especially Ganesha, who we saw EVERYWHERE! So, more for me to do over the summer!

What are the requirements to be a Christian? Orthodoxy wise.


I know a lot of Orthodox churches hold ethnicity really high when you're looking to join (liturgy is usually done in the language of the country of origin, for instance). The church I did a lot of work with last year was a mission though, and most of the congregation was Dutch, even though it was the Antioch church. If you can find an Antioch church or mission, that'd probably be your best bet. The Antioch churches I've been to have all had very kind and accepting members. I went to the mission for Pascha last year and a couple of women asked me if I'd help them with the choir after I told them I was a music major. Mostly I just suggest visiting a church or a mission and talking to the congregation and the priest.

Here are a couple of links: Antiochian Orthodox Christian Archdiocese and Othrodox Church of America. I'm not as familiar with the first, but the OCA has a wonderful Q&A section, and a bunch of articles. It's been over a year since I've looked at either of these though...
